Understanding the Client’s Requirements
Make My House Warmer operates in a competitive home improvement sector where trust, clarity, and local visibility are essential. The client needed a website that clearly explained different insulation services, answered common homeowner questions, and supported enquiries through phone calls and contact forms.
Key requirements included:
- Clear service pages for loft insulation, internal wall insulation, external wall insulation, wall rendering, wall plastering, and uPVC windows and doors
- Strong local targeting for South West London
- Easy-to-read content for homeowners with no technical background
- A modern design that reflects quality workmanship
- SEO foundations that support long-term growth
- Fast loading times across desktop and mobile
The website also needed to scale easily as new services and blog content are added.
Website Structure and User Experience
The site structure was carefully planned to make navigation simple and logical. Each service has its own dedicated page, supported by internal linking that guides users naturally through related services.
Clear calls to action appear throughout the site, encouraging visitors to call, submit a contact form, or explore related services. Content sections are broken into short paragraphs, icon-led features, and visual blocks to keep pages easy to scan.
Mobile usability was a priority, as many homeowners search for insulation services on their phones. The layout adapts smoothly across screen sizes, with clear menus, readable text, and accessible contact details.
Technologies Used
WordPress
Elementor Pro
Elementor Pro was used to design all page layouts. This allowed for full design control while keeping the site lightweight and fast. Custom sections, reusable templates, and responsive layouts were created to maintain visual consistency across the website.
Elementor Pro also supports advanced forms, mobile responsiveness, and clean HTML output, all of which help with usability and search visibility.
Yoast SEO
Yoast SEO was installed and configured to manage on-page optimisation. Each page includes:
- Custom SEO titles
- Meta descriptions
- Clean URL structures
- XML sitemaps
- Proper heading hierarchy
Yoast also helps ensure new content follows SEO best practices as the site grows.
FileBird Media Management
FileBird was used to organise media files within WordPress. This keeps images structured by service type and page, making content updates faster and reducing the risk of unused or duplicate files affecting performance.
SEO Optimisation Strategy
SEO was built into the project from the start, not added later. Each service page targets specific search intent related to home insulation in South West London.
On-Page SEO
Each page was carefully optimised with:
- Clear H1, H2, and H3 heading structure
- Location-based keywords used naturally within content
- Descriptive internal links between related services
- Optimised image alt text
- Clear page intent aligned with user searches
Service pages focus on answering real homeowner questions, which helps improve engagement and time on site.
Local SEO Focus
Local targeting was a major priority. Content consistently references South West London in a natural way, supporting visibility in local search results.
Contact details are clearly displayed, and service areas are reinforced throughout the site. This helps search engines understand where the business operates and who the services are for.
Performance and Core Web Vitals
Page speed and performance were optimised using:
- Clean Elementor layouts
- Optimised images
- Minimal plugin usage
- Mobile-first design
Fast loading pages help improve user experience and support better rankings.
Content Strategy and Information Architecture
The content was written to balance SEO with readability. Insulation services can be technical, so the content avoids jargon and explains benefits clearly.
Each service page includes:
- A clear introduction explaining the service
- Benefits for homeowners
- Visual feature sections
- Internal links to related services
- Clear calls to action
The FAQ section helps address common concerns, reduces friction, and supports long-tail search queries.
The blog section was structured to allow ongoing content creation around insulation tips, energy efficiency, and home improvement advice.
Long-Term SEO Action Plan
To support continued growth, the website was built with a long-term SEO plan in mind.
Recommended ongoing actions include:
- Publishing regular blog posts focused on insulation advice and seasonal topics
- Expanding FAQs based on customer enquiries
- Adding service area pages for specific towns and boroughs
- Monitoring performance using Google Search Console
- Updating existing content as services evolve
- Continuing internal linking between new and existing pages
The structure allows these updates without redesign or technical changes.
